Exploring the Natural Beauty of Lewis and Clark State Park

Named after the famous explorers who traveled through the area in the early 1800s, Lewis and Clark State Park boasts rolling hills, breathtaking views, forests, and wildlife. The park is home to an incredible 22 miles of shoreline of Lake Sakakawea, which offers opportunities for fishing, swimming, and boating. The park also has several hiking trails that take visitors through the natural beauty of the surrounding landscape.

Hiking Trails

Lewis and Clark State Park has several hiking trails, but the most popular is the Ma-ak-oti Trail, which is a 3.5-mile trail that loops through the park. The trail is relatively easy, making it perfect for beginners and families with kids. The Trail showcases the spectacular views of Lake Sakakawea and the surrounding landscape. Another well-known trail is the Overlook Trail that provides an awesome view of Lake Sakakawea.

Additional Outdoor Activities to Enjoy in Lewis and Clark State Park

Aside from hiking, Lewis and Clark State Park has an array of outdoor activities to enjoy, including:

Camping

The park has over 100 campsites that are available year-round. The campsites are located throughout the park, with amenities including electric hookups, showers, and toilets.

Fishing

Lake Sakakawea is home to several species of fish, making it a popular fishing spot to land catfish, walleye, and northern pike.

Boating

Boating is popular on Lake Sakakawea, with boat ramps and a marina available for use.
